Coping with Iran's rising prices | Coping with Iran's rising prices |
(19 minutes later) | |
Four young Iranians have written to BBCPersian.com about the rising cost of living - and food prices - in Tehran. | Four young Iranians have written to BBCPersian.com about the rising cost of living - and food prices - in Tehran. |
HESAMMODIN | HESAMMODIN |
The price of dairy products has gone up gradually over the last few months, but last week it suddenly soared by 15%. | The price of dairy products has gone up gradually over the last few months, but last week it suddenly soared by 15%. |
The same inflation can be seen on the prices of tinned food, tea and bread. Tehran food shopping class="" href="/1/hi/in_pictures/7517319.stm">See more food shopping pictures | |
I think people should boycott these products in protest and make the producers price their products more logically. | I think people should boycott these products in protest and make the producers price their products more logically. |
